SD Gundam GP-03 Dendrobium (Bandai; 200X)
Materials used: Tamiya sprays, Model Masters acrylics, Krylon acrylic spray, Testors Dull Cote, Gundam markers, generic paint markers, basic hobby tools
This was a kit I bought a long time ago when Big Lots got a bunch of ultra-cheap Gundam kits leftover from that one time when gunpla was very popular in the U.S. It sat in a box for years and I actually forgot I had it until recently when I was looking through my boxes of old gunpla stuff.
It was fun to make and I tried one new thing, namely the Krylon acrylic spray as a matte topcoat. (I don't recommend it. It created a bumpy texture on the plastic and really isn't meant for such small objects.)
I've always loved the Dendrobium for how massive it is, but after seeing 0083 recently I'll just say I'm more of a fan of the mecha than the anime.
